Introdution: Ischemic mitral regurgitation (IMR) remains one of the most complex and unresolved aspects of ischemic heart disease that the impact of percutaneous coronary INTERVENTION (PCI) on improvement of intensity of ischemic mitral regurgitation is not well clarified. Patients with coronary artery diseases and ischemic mitral regurgitation have a worse prognosis than the patients with coronary artery disease (CAD) and those without ischemic mitral regurgitation. We sought to investigate the impact of complete revascularization by percutaneous coronary INTERVENTION PCI on improvement of IMR in patients with CAD and comparisons of echocardiography indices in patients with and without improvement of ischemic mitral regurgitation. Methods: In this cross sectional retrospective study, echocardiographic reports in pre-percutaneous coronary INTERVENTION time and 12 months after PCI of patients with moderate (≥ 2+) ischemic mitral regurgitation who underwent complete revascularization by percutaneous coronary INTERVENTION from Farvardin 1391 to Esfand 1393 were included in the study. Then, echocardiographic data of the patients with improved ischemic mitral regurgitation compared with the patients with non-improved ischemic mitral regurgitation. Results: Comparison of echocardiographic indices before and after percutaneous coronary INTERVENTION revealed that after percutaneous coronary INTERVENTION (P = 0. 002) in 15 patients (16%), improvement in ischemic mitral regurgitation was occurred. Also, left ventricular ejection fraction (P = 0. 010), left ventricular end-diastolic (P = 0. 003) and end-systolic diameters (P < 0. 001), wall motion score index (P = 0. 003), left atrial area (P = 0. 001) and systolic pulmonary artery pressure (P = 0. 046) in pre-percutaneous coronary INTERVENTION echocardiography were different between improved and none-improved IMR group. Conclusion: Although, percutaneous coronary INTERVENTION can lead to improvement of ischemic mitral regurgitation but most patients did not show improvement of ischemic mitral regurgitation after percutaneous coronary INTERVENTION. The structural abnormality of left ventricle and atrium were different between improved and none-improved IMR group.

There have been different views on the extent of the INTERVENTION of the GOVERNMENTs, and even the GOVERNMENT INTERVENTION itself, in culture. Different schools, on the basis of their own definitions of culture (from limiting culture to art at one end of the spectrum to considering it as a macro or omnipresent entity at the other end) and those of GOVERNMENT (from a minimal view of the GOVERNMENT on one side of the spectrum to a maximum one on the other side) have taken special positions on this issue. This study is an attempt to answer the question of ‘what is the extent of the INTERVENTION of a religious GOVERNMENT in culture? ’ In this research, documentary method has been adopted to study the concepts, background of the research, and the theoretical studies. Then, through descriptive-analytical method, the limits of the INTERVENTION of the religious GOVERNMENT in three levels of supervision, support, and being in charge in the areas of (1) economy of culture, (2) implementation of the cultural affairs, and (3) rights of culture (policy making, legislation, and making regulations on culture have been explained. Under normal circumstances, in the field of the economy of culture, only supervision is approved, while in implementation of cultural affairs, only being in charge is not approved. Of course, in abnormal conditions (lack of the realization of public interests), the findings are different as they have been mentioned in the summary section. In the field of cultural rights, the level of oversight and support is approved and in the level of being in charge in macro-policy-making and legislation, they should be done in terms of social inclination, and in micro-policy-making and regulations, they should be done with the participation of other beneficiaries.

At first, the economic efficiency has been brought up in economics and then developed as a superior normative purpose and value in another areas such as law. Accordingly, many areas including the free market, the contracts and their related laws have been formed with regard to this normative purpose and its implications and are going to obtain the most interests and achievements, while they spend the least level of resources. emphasizing the assumptions such as existence of full competition in the market and full information and rationality of the parties, the classic economists believe that market performs its role without GOVERNMENT INTERVENTION and achieves economic efficiency. But, incorrectness of classic economics assumptions and failure of the free market, the contracts and the law governing them, proved failure. Therefore, with regard to importance of the economic efficiency, it must obtained by another way. It is exactly the GOVERNMENT INTERVENTION in the contracts throgh some rules of the nature of public law; a method which is subject of criticism. Of course, its negative effects are reduciable and therefore economic efficiency in the contracts can be achieved throgh the GOVERNMENT INTERVENTION. In this article, different viewpoints about the issue will be discussed.

The issue of the position of GOVERNMENT and its role in economy has been debated by economists and scholars of various economic academies since the creation of economical knowledge. Since foretime especially in recent decades Muslim scholars have studied different aspects of this issue. In this paper the role of GOVERNMENT in economy from the perspective of Muslim scholars would be examined. The viewpoint of lbnKhaldun, martyr Sadr, Motahari, Beheshti and Imam khomeini (RA) has been studied. The basis of Islamic GOVERNMENT in the economy is expedient and the purpose of expediency is providing legislator target in order to make people to achieve worldly and otherworldly benefits. Therefore, development of idealism, creation and security expansion, economic growth and social justice are factors in which the Islamic GOVERNMENT intervenes in order to realize them in economic affairs. This is reflected in the ideas being discussed. By a brief reflection on the works of thinkers we come to the conclusion that though they would believe the GOVERNMENT is kind of human made phenomenon and consider to fallible rulers, they would never hesitate in necessity of GOVERNMENT. In fact there are different approaches regarding the origin of legitimation and GOVERNMENT obedience and political obligatory issue but most of scholars are fond of creating welfare and justice on morality and freedom.

This study has tried to investigate the GOVERNMENT INTERVENTION in Chiken meat market and the effect of this INTERVENTION with usage of fluid correlated markets. Thus the effect of four policy groups have been simulated that are "increasing the price of chiken meat", "varying the price of meal", "varying the price of broiler chicks", "varying the price of corn". The results show that increasing the price of Chiken by 1%, will cause its production to increase.13% and its demand to decrease by.58%. Furthermore, increasing the price of meal by 1% will cause the hen meat to increase.56% and this issue will cause its demand to decrease.32% Increasing the corn price by 1%, will increase the end price of hen meat by.86% and will decrease its consumption.5%. Increasing the price of broiler chicks by 1%, will cause the end price of hen meat to increase.9% and decrease demand up to.53%.

The demand for green products has increased in the past few years due to the heightened awareness of environmental issues and the increasing use of green products by consumers. Thus, choosing the best strategy for green product manufacturers is essential. At the same time, producers and retailers are likely to have their decisions influenced by GOVERNMENT actions. In this study, we attempt to determine the product's price and greenness within two competitive supply chains. The study investigates the pricing of two substitutable and green products in which each supply chain produces a green product. Using Nash and Stackelberg Game models, we determine how supply chains and their members interact. A Nash model involves two competing supply chains with equal power, within each supply chain, however, there is a Stackelberg competition between the retailer and the manufacturer. The Stackelberg model assumes that one of the supply chains is the market leader. The results show that with increasing GOVERNMENT INTERVENTION (GOVERNMENT's adjustment factor and green level floor for subsidies), regardless of Nash or Stackelberg structures, the green level of the product will increase, and wholesale and retail prices will decrease. Additionally, the price changes in the retailer-Stackelberg structure are greater than those in the manufacturer-Stackelberg structure. Also, by bearing the greenness cost by the manufacturer or retailer, companies can positively impact their profits as well as the level of greenness in their products. When the manufacturer makes an investment in greenness, the retailer and consumer benefit from it, and ultimately become the main force behind the development of green products.

GOVERNMENT INTERVENTION is one of the significant issues in economics. Hence, the study of the effects of GOVERNMENT behavior on market is a very necessary issue. The question that arises regarding dramatic arts is whether GOVERNMENT INTERVENTION has been effective in increasing efficiency of theater? The present article is an attempt to study the effect of GOVERNMENT INTERVENTION on efficiency of production and the optimum border of GOVERNMENT INTERVENTION in theater production. Linear, inverse U, and threshold specifications were used for the analysis of the data garnered from 120 plays produced in Tehran. The data for this research were collected by a reliable questionnaire based on test-retest approach. The threshold level results indicate that in most cases GOVERNMENT INTERVENTION has been more than optimum level and has reduced the efficiency of theater production. The results of linear specifications and inverse U are either negative and significant or insignificant. In sum, although these results do not prescribe lack of GOVERNMENT INTERVENTION, they suggest that the GOVERNMENT pays more attention to the impacts of its INTERVENTIONs. Moreover, the GOVERNMENT in each INTERVENTION should take into consideration the border of effective INTERVENTION
